Summary
A.J. Francis and KC Navarro will face off in a SacTown Street Fight on Thursday night’s “Impact” special. Francis claims he helped Navarro get opportunities in the wrestling world and predicts he will beat Navarro “within an inch of his life.” Navarro has been making excuses, including mentioning a sick uncle, which Francis dismisses. Francis says he has no desire to make up with Navarro, blaming him for costing him opportunities in the past.
